Sustaining synthetic chlorinated pools demands normal checking of chlorine stages and drinking water top quality. Pool operators and homeowners should check the chlorine focus routinely to make certain it stays inside the proposed assortment. Way too minor chlorine can cause insufficient sanitation, letting germs and algae to prosper. Alternatively, extreme chlorine degrees can cause pores and skin and eye discomfort for swimmers. The best chlorine degree for artificial chlorinated pools usually falls involving one and 3 areas for each million (ppm). Retaining this equilibrium is important for furnishing a snug and Safe and sound swimming experience.
In addition to chlorine degrees, artificial chlorinated pools involve suitable pH equilibrium. The pH of pool h2o ought to Preferably be involving 7.2 and seven.6. If the pH is simply too minimal, the h2o gets acidic, bringing about corrosion of pool equipment and irritation for swimmers. Should the pH is simply too substantial, chlorine will become much less successful, reducing its capability to sanitize the drinking water. Common screening and adjustment of pH amounts aid be sure that synthetic chlorinated pools continue being perfectly-balanced and comfy for people. Pool entrepreneurs usually use pH testing kits and chemical adjustments to take care of the right pH levels of their pools.
One more significant aspect of artificial chlorinated swimming pools is the usage of st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ade speedily when exposed to daylight, lowering its usefulness being a disinfectant. To fight this, pool entrepreneurs generally insert c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that assists lengthen the life of chlorine in outside swimming pools. Devoid of stabilizers, chlorine concentrations can fall swiftly, necessitating Regular additions to maintain good sanitation. By utilizing the suitable quantity of stabilizer, artificial chlorinated pools can remain cleaner for extended intervals with nominal chlorine reduction.
Artificial chlorinated swimming pools also need plan maintenance over and above chemical balancing. Filtration methods Engage in a vital purpose in keeping the drinking water clean by eliminating debris, Dust, and natural make any difference. Pool filters, which includes s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, aid lure impurities and forestall them from circulating within the water. Standard cleansing and backwashing of filters make sure they perform competently. Also, pool entrepreneurs should really skim the drinking water area, vacuum the pool flooring, and brush the pool partitions to stop algae buildup and preserve water clarity. Good maintenance assists synthetic chlorinated swimming pools stay in ideal ailment for swimmers.

In recent times, There have been an increased target eco-welcoming answers for artificial chlorinated swimming pools. Some pool owners and operators are Discovering techniques to cut down chemical usage even though sustaining water good quality. A person option is the use of ozone or ultraviolet (UV) mild techniques, which operate alongside chlorine to enhance disinfection and cut down the quantity of chemical compounds desired. These units enable stop working contaminants and cut down chlorine byproducts, generating the water gentler around the pores and skin and eyes. Additionally, advancements in filtration technologies have enhanced the effectiveness of h2o circulation and purification, contributing to cleaner plus much more sustainable pool upkeep techniques.
Regardless of the a lot of benefits of artificial chlorinated swimming pools, it can be crucial for pool proprietors and operators to stick to protection pointers and greatest practices. Suitable storage and managing of chlorine and also other pool chemicals are important to stop mishaps and chemical imbalances. Chlorine really should be saved inside of a cool, dry location from immediate daylight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emical substances, which include ammonia or acids, can make hazardous reactions. Pool routine maintenance staff ought to be experienced in chemical safety and stick to advised recommendations for dealing with and software.
